Employment Type:* Part time *Shift:* Rotating Shift *Description:* *RNs for TeleSafe project for NY State - Per Diem* TeleSAFE provides comprehensive, compassionate care to survivors of sexual assault in New York. The program, which is delivered through telehealth, partners with NY State hospitals to train, support, or even conduct full exams (in partnership with the onsite nurses) 24/7/365. We work with a wide range of facilities all over the state, including large hospitals that simply need backup coverage or training, to rural hospitals with no existing SAFE program at all. RN II (TeleSAFE) serve in an on-call capacity. When hospital partners call us, they may be seeking answers to basic questions, partnership in completing an exam, or seeking a SAFE to fully manage a case remotely.
